Overview of my CV:
Kristian Wanzl Nekrasov attended the diploma acting education at the Schauspiel-Akademie Zürich, Switzerland, in 1985. He then made his way into a variety of theatre engagements, including Schauspiel Bonn, the Staatstheater Hannover, the Maxim Gorki Theater Berlin, the German Theatre Berlin and the Berliner Ensemble.
He performed over 120 roles including Alceste in "Misanthrope" by Moliere, Prior Walter in Tony Kushner's "Angels in America", Orestes in "Andromache" of Racine and Lopachin in Anton Chekhov's "Cherry Orchard". In addition to his regular work for theatre, Kristian Wanzl Nekrasov appeared in numerous television series, TV movies and in films, both in leading and supporting roles.
He is the founder of the Actors Studio Studio 22" in Berlin. There and at other theatres such as at the Theatre Ulm, at the Theatre Ravensburg, at the Greenhouse Theatre Berlin and at the European Institute of Theatre in Berlin he directed various plays, for example „Sleeping around" by Ravenhill, The Messiah" by Patrick Barlow, or Hysterikon" by Ingrid Lausund.
Besides his teaching at numerous acting schools like the Academy Berlin, the Etage, the Film Acting School Berlin, the University of Arts in Augsburg, the E.T.I. Berlin, the University of Dramatic Arts in Graz, Austria, the John DeSotelle Studio NY and
the Susan Batson Studio in NYC he is involved in a lot of set -- coaching for film production companies and private coaching for actors.
